#bcd448 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bcd448 is composed of 73.7% red, 83.1%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 66%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 70.3 degrees, a saturation of 61.9% and a lightness of 55.7%. #bcd448 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ff90 with #79a900. Closest websafe color is: #cccc33.

Shades and Tints of #bcd448
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070802 is the darkest color, while #fcfdf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#bcd448
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8e8e8e is the less saturated color, while #d3f725 is the most saturated one.
